PictView: artefakty v obrázku při neceločíselném zvětšení

Hlášení chyb a problémů programu Altap Salamander. Buďte, prosím, ve svých popisech co nejpodrobnější a vytvořte pro každý incident nový příspěvek. Nevkládejte programem generovaná hlášení o pádu programu, pošlete je e-mailem.
User avatar
zarevak
Plugin Developer
Plugin Developer
Posts: 789
Joined: 04 Feb 2006, 16:49
Location: Prague, Czech Republic

PictView: artefakty v obrázku při neceločíselném zvětšení

Post by zarevak »

Dobrý den,
toto je velmí stará (zaokrouhlovací?) chybka v PictView. Pokud zvětším zobrazený obrázek na nějaké neceločíselné zvětšení (například: 4 x 2^(2/3) = 634,604...%) a obrázek posunu, tak se původní pixely posouvají pod myší ale nově nakreslené s těmi původními nesedí a dělá to ošklivé věci :(

Podezřelé je, že k tomuto dochází jen ve horizontálním směru.

Systém: WinXP SP3 Pro EN, AS 2.51, GPU: Ati X1650 AGP, Catalyst 8.12
Attachments
ukázka artefaktů v PictView
ukázka artefaktů v PictView
pictview_artfakty.png (12.61 KiB) Viewed 8788 times
Jan Rysavy
ALTAP Staff
ALTAP Staff
Posts: 5231
Joined: 08 Dec 2005, 06:34
Location: Novy Bor, Czech Republic
Contact:

Post by Jan Rysavy »

Poznámka: problém se projevuje také při překreslování plochy po tooltipu (Pipette mode). Co jsem pozoroval, zlobí to pod každým OS a každou grafickou kartou / ovladači, které jsem měl k dispozici.
Jan Rysavy
ALTAP Staff
ALTAP Staff
Posts: 5231
Joined: 08 Dec 2005, 06:34
Location: Novy Bor, Czech Republic
Contact:

PictView: artefakty v obrázku při neceločíselném zvětšení

Post by Jan Rysavy »

Zřejmě souvisí také s přiloženým problémem, kdy označovací klec nesedí na jednotlivé body? Stačí měnit velikost okna a klec mění svou pozici.
Attachments
err4.png
err4.png (21.01 KiB) Viewed 8783 times
Jan Patera
Plugin Developer
Plugin Developer
Posts: 707
Joined: 08 Dec 2005, 14:33
Location: Prague, Czech Republic
Contact:

Re: PictView: artefakty v obrázku při neceločíselném zvětšení

Post by Jan Patera »

zarevak wrote:Dobrý den,
toto je velmí stará (zaokrouhlovací?) chybka v PictView. Pokud zvětším zobrazený obrázek na nějaké neceločíselné zvětšení (například: 4 x 2^(2/3) = 634,604...%) a obrázek posunu, tak se původní pixely posouvají pod myší ale nově nakreslené s těmi původními nesedí a dělá to ošklivé věci :(
Stejny problem jako zde. Nezavisle na HW, OS nebo ovladacich.
User avatar
zarevak
Plugin Developer
Plugin Developer
Posts: 789
Joined: 04 Feb 2006, 16:49
Location: Prague, Czech Republic

Post by zarevak »

:oops: já jsem asi blázen... jsem se snažil dohledat, zda to tu nebylo zmíněno, a nic nenašel. A teď jsem byl nachytán, že přímo já jsem už jednou o problému psal :oops:
Jan Rysavy
ALTAP Staff
ALTAP Staff
Posts: 5231
Joined: 08 Dec 2005, 06:34
Location: Novy Bor, Czech Republic
Contact:

Post by Jan Rysavy »

To je přesně důvod, proč se snažíme hlášené problémy řešit, jinak se vracejí a člověk chodí v kruzích. Jsou ale situace, kdy řešení je zkrátka netriviální (Unicode pro Salamandera například) a toto je zřejmě jedna z nich. Honza Patera poslední dva měsíce investoval do oprav a vylepšení ostatních pluginů, což bude pro uživatele určitě hodně znatelné.
User avatar
zarevak
Plugin Developer
Plugin Developer
Posts: 789
Joined: 04 Feb 2006, 16:49
Location: Prague, Czech Republic

Post by zarevak »

Původně jsem si říkal, že se jen někde opraví zaokrouhlování a bude to 8) Když si ale vzpomenu na zaokrouhlovací komplikace, které jsem řešil ve svém pluginu (který žije - pokusím se během týdne zaslat ukázku), tak vím, že je to někdy docela maso všechno ohlídat...
Jan Rysavy
ALTAP Staff
ALTAP Staff
Posts: 5231
Joined: 08 Dec 2005, 06:34
Location: Novy Bor, Czech Republic
Contact:

Post by Jan Rysavy »

zarevak wrote:ve svém pluginu (který žije - pokusím se během týdne zaslat ukázku)
Tak to je skvělá zpráva! Těšíme se na preview!
k0nelupy

Post by k0nelupy »

zarevak wrote::oops: já jsem asi blázen... jsem se snažil dohledat, zda to tu nebylo zmíněno, a nic nenašel. A teď jsem byl nachytán, že přímo já jsem už jednou o problému psal :oops:
OT: taky nekdy nemuzu najit neco o cem se tady urcite mluvilo napr. viz
http://forum.altap.cz/viewtopic.php?p=13264
ani ten google mi nepomohl :-(
Jan Patera
Plugin Developer
Plugin Developer
Posts: 707
Joined: 08 Dec 2005, 14:33
Location: Prague, Czech Republic
Contact:

Re: PictView: artefakty v obrázku při neceločíselném zvětšení

Post by Jan Patera »

Jan Patera wrote:
zarevak wrote:Dobrý den,
toto je velmí stará (zaokrouhlovací?) chybka v PictView. Pokud zvětším zobrazený obrázek na nějaké neceločíselné zvětšení (například: 4 x 2^(2/3) = 634,604...%) a obrázek posunu, tak se původní pixely posouvají pod myší ale nově nakreslené s těmi původními nesedí a dělá to ošklivé věci :(
Stejny problem jako zde. Nezavisle na HW, OS nebo ovladacich.
Problem snad vyresen pro pristi verzi Salamandera (AS 2.52), nebo aspon zlepsen o 99%. Zatimco dosud mohla odchylka cinit az tolik pixelu, o kolikanasobny zoom slo, ted by jen v ojedinelych pripadech mohla byt pouze 1 pixel. Snad to nema vedlejsi efekty na rychlosti...
Post Reply